The current source of conflict between Ivangorod, Russia, and Narva, Estonia, primarily stems from historical and geopolitical tensions, particularly related to borders and national identity. Both cities are situated on opposite sides of the Narva River, and their relationship has been affected by Estonia's post-Soviet independence and its alignment with Western institutions, contrasting with Russia's influence in the region. Additionally, issues surrounding minority rights and cultural heritage further exacerbate the tensions between these neighboring communities.
